Responsibilities

As a Data Analytics Analyst at IQVIA, you will play a pivotal role in delivering actionable insights and ensuring quality in eConsent processes. Key responsibilities include:

  • Digitizing Informed Consent Forms (ICFs): Use basic HTML coding to convert source ICFs into digital formats, ensuring accuracy and compliance with standards.
  • Quality Control: Perform tiered quality checks to maintain consistency between digitized ICFs and source documents.
  • Task Management: Efficiently manage workloads using the task management system, adhering to queue standards.
  • Prioritization and Delivery: Plan and prioritize tasks based on escalations and directives from trainers, managers, and study teams.
  • Collaboration: Work with customer success, operations, and project management teams to streamline processes and keep documentation updated in real time.
  • Internal Audits: Conduct and document quarterly audits for the Customer Success (CS) team to ensure delivery quality and identify process enhancements.
  • eConsent Support: Confirm system adaptability and functionality for eConsent sites and act as a Subject Matter Expert (SME) for eConsent content.
  • Access Management: Provide consent access to sponsors, sites, and study team members, and conduct quarterly user access reviews for accurate documentation.
  • Process Improvement: Proactively suggest ideas to optimize delivery timelines and enhance quality.
